Introduction

Stembridge School is a private multilingual day school in Vilnius that combines the Lithuanian national curriculum with Cambridge International programmes, enrolling students aged 5–18. Cambridge Primary and Lower Secondary run to age 14, followed by Cambridge IGCSE, AS and A Levels. Instruction is delivered in Russian, English, and Lithuanian, with bilingual Grade 1 classes taught by two teachers—a Russian-speaker and an English-speaker. Cambridge International accreditation underpins assessment and progression. Enrollment for 2026/2027 is open for Grades 1–10; on completing Grade 10, pupils receive the Lithuanian state certificate and Cambridge IGCSE; after Grade 12 they gain both the Lithuanian diploma and Cambridge AS/A Levels. The school day starts at 9:00 and combines 45-minute classes with 80-minute modules, including a long midday break and dedicated self-study. The Vilnius campus relocated to Nemenčinės pl. 48 in 2024. The kindergarten (ages 2–7) moved to Žalgirio g. 135 in 2026. Facilities include a large hall, a closed playground, a school bus service, and meals provided by accredited suppliers for breakfast, lunch and snacks.

Fees

Annual tuition at Stembridge School ranges from EUR 7,000 to EUR 7,600 for 2026/27.

Application / Registration Fee

- One-time registration fee (paid upon admission): EUR 400.00.
- Early-signing discount: where the contract is signed before May 1, the registration fee is reduced to EUR 300.00.

Tuition fees (annual and per term — per-grade grouping)

Tuition covers scheduled classes from 09:00 to 15:45 and supervised self-study time at school.

- Bilingual Grades 1–3: EUR 7,500.00 per year. Per term (if billed in three equal instalments): EUR 2,500.00 per term.
- Grade 4: EUR 7,000.00 per year. Per term (if billed in three equal instalments): EUR 2,333.33 per term.
- Grades 5–8: EUR 7,200.00 per year. Per term (if billed in three equal instalments): EUR 2,400.00 per term.
- Grades 9–10: EUR 7,600.00 per year. Per term (if billed in three equal instalments): EUR 2,533.33 per term.

- Sibling discount: 10% discount applies to the second (and subsequent) child.

Mandatory additional annual charges

- Annual educational materials fee: EUR 450.00 (paid each year).

Meals and catering (charged separately)

- Breakfast: EUR 2.40 per serving.
- Lunch: EUR 5.80 per serving.
- Dinner (afternoon snack / light meal): EUR 2.60 per serving.

Extended day and supervision

- Extended Day Programme (supervision, outdoor time and dinner; available from 15:45 to 18:30): EUR 90.00 per month.

Curriculum

Children learn in Russian, English, and Lithuanian according to the Lithuanian national curriculum and Cambridge International Education programmes. Bilingual classes use a team-teaching model with two teachers—one Russian-speaking and one English-speaking. Cambridge International accreditation is held. Enrollment for the 2026/2027 academic year is open for Grades 1–10. Upon completing Grade 10, students receive the Lithuanian state certificate and the Cambridge IGCSE; after Grade 12, students earn both the Lithuanian diploma and the Cambridge International AS & A Level Certificate. The school day starts at 9:00 and includes traditional 45-minute classes and 80-minute modules, with a long midday break and dedicated self-study time.

Student Teacher Ratio

Up to 20 students per class.

Gifted and Talented

Individualised Development Paths are provided to tailor learning to each student's strengths. The school uses interdisciplinary learning, projects, and productive failures to develop students' talents.
